How To Spaghettify Your Dog : and other science secrets of the universe by Hiba Noor Khan

A wonderfully illustrated, jam-packed, must-have science book for all aspiring young physicists!' The Royal Institution 'Lively, humorous and stuffed with enticing images and outrageous puns' The GuardianHave you ever wondered how to slow down time? Or what would happen if you fell into a black hole? Well, wonder no more. This book is bursting with fascinating physics facts that will explain everything you want to know, and more, about the curiosities of our cosmos. Featuring easy-to-follow experiments, eye-catching illustrations and plenty of laugh-out-loud moments, this book will demystify physics and bring science to life.; 64 pages; 17/08/2023
